Hi Guys,

I have a 2009 Aurion AT-X, I have a set of leather seats I want to install and I was wondering if there is a wiring loom somewhere handy to plug the electronic passenger seat into as my original one is manual, or will this need to be wired in by a auto electrican? Also, can anyone forsee any other problems with changing the seats or are they just a simple swap over?

I'm not sure whether where to plug the wiring harness to the car. But I've talk to a guy at toyota dealer about this, and there is the wiring harness to do the job (seatbelt, airbag, power) for about $185.

I will get an auto electrician to do the job to wire up the front passenger side.

Front driver side, should just be fine.

Rear seat should be fine. The bottom part is lift off. The back rest is attached with 2 bolt and lift off as well.

As simple as that.

Hope that help.

Well, since they will bolt on I will put in my 2 cents:

I have put electric seats into my Camry (bought some facelift ones a while ago); the airbag plug remained the same and we just stole power from one of my amps to power the seats. I haven't had any issues with it since I put them in a year or so ago.

Yep all the plug remain the same.

Just need the power for the front passenger.

Easy way is like what you said or share power from driver.

But if OP wants proper way then will need the harness from toyota which is EXPENSIVE.
